What is Mike Portnoy's Biography?
Mike Portnoy's journey as a drummer began at a young age. He took formal lessons and spent countless hours mastering his craft. His dedication led him to form Dream Theater in 1985, along with John Petrucci and John Myung. The band quickly gained a following for their complex compositions and virtuosic performances. Portnoy's contributions were pivotal in shaping the band's sound, making them one of the leading acts in progressive metal.

How Did Mike Portnoy Start His Career?
Mike Portnoy's career began in the mid-1980s when he co-founded Dream Theater. The band's debut album, "When Dream and Day Unite," was released in 1989, and it set the stage for their meteoric rise in the progressive metal scene. Portnoy's drumming was not just about keeping time; it was about creating intricate soundscapes that complemented the band's complex arrangements. His work on albums like "Images and Words" and "Metropolis Pt. 2: Scenes from a Memory" solidified his status as a drumming virtuoso.

What is Mike Portnoy's Drumming Style?
Mike Portnoy's drumming style is a blend of technical skill and emotional expression. He is known for his use of odd time signatures, intricate fills, and a wide range of dynamics. His ability to seamlessly transition between complex rhythmic patterns and powerful, driving beats is a hallmark of his playing. Portnoy often incorporates various drumming techniques, including:
- Blast Beats
- Polyrhythms
- Ghost Notes
- Double Bass Techniques
Why Did Mike Portnoy Leave Dream Theater?
In 2010, Mike Portnoy made the shocking decision to leave Dream Theater after 25 years with the band. This unexpected departure led to much speculation and discussion among fans and the music community. Portnoy cited a desire for new challenges and creative freedom as his reasons for leaving. His departure marked a significant turning point for both him and the band, leading to the introduction of drummer Mike Mangini as his replacement.
What Are Mike Portnoy's Current Projects?
Since leaving Dream Theater, Mike Portnoy has been involved in various musical projects. He co-founded The Winery Dogs, a rock supergroup featuring Billy Sheehan and Richie Kotzen. The band has released several successful albums and gained acclaim for their powerful performances. Additionally, Portnoy has continued to collaborate with various artists, showcasing his versatility and passion for music.
